People like to talk - Just as your reputation matters in real life, your online reputation matters too.
If people were talking about you privately, we’d guess you’d want to know, right? Well, if people are talking about you online, it isn’t private, so other people can and will know what they’re saying. But so can you, you can listen, and you can respond. If you listen and respond in the right way, just as in a face-to-face conversation, you can strengthen your reputation. In business, this means strengthening your brand. Social media, is here, it’s growing, and it won’t go away either.
Embracing it – listening and engaging offers many potential benefits. Yes, there are pitfalls too, so it’s worth you having a plan to make the most of it.
